Hormones, am I right? When you’re expecting, the hormones in your body change so much, and play a huge role in how your body works. Specifically, estrogen and progesterone are two hormones that have such a dramatic increase during pregnancy, and affect vascular development, mood swings, milk duct development, and hair changes.
